|
|
ВсегоКОплате |
☑ |
|
0
a103307
01.03.12
✎
09:46
|
1С 8.2 УТ 10.3
Мне нужно добавить в внешнюю форму "счет на оплату покупателя" строчку "Всего к оплате". В макете на том месте находится НП. Что такое НП я так и не понял. В модуле никакой НП нет. Скопировал из оригинального счета все строчки (и идущие вместе с ними) "Всего к оплате". При попытке распечатать счет пишет:
-*-*-*-*-*-*-*-*-*-*
{ВнешняяОбработка.ПечатнаяФормаСчета.МодульОбъекта(630)}: Ошибка при вызове метода контекста (ПолучитьОбласть)
по причине:
Область не найдена: ВсегоКОплате
-*-*-*-*-*-*-*-*-*-*
Короче вопрос, господа. Как добавить строчку "Всего к оплате" в счет?
|
|
|
1
a103307
01.03.12
✎
09:47
|
Запарол разметку.
|
|
|
2
Любопытная
01.03.12
✎
09:47
|
НП это налог с продаж. Его отменили, а форма осталась
|
|
|
3
БибиГон
01.03.12
✎
09:47
|
пригласить специалиста. )
|
|
|
4
Любопытная
01.03.12
✎
09:48
|
Область у тебя не определена с таким названием, что не понятно?
|
|
|
5
a103307
01.03.12
✎
09:51
|
(4) Ну в оригинальной форме она получается тоже не определена, однако там все в порядке, а тут не выводит.
|
|
|
6
Wobland
01.03.12
✎
09:52
|
(5) значит, в оригинальной форме дело не доходит до выполнения этой строки. Любопытная всё верно сказала, думай
|
|
|
7
a103307
01.03.12
✎
09:55
|
(6) Что она сказала? Повторила текст ошибки? Зашибись.
|
|
|
8
Капитан О
01.03.12
✎
09:56
|
кто меня звал?
|
|
|
9
Любопытная
01.03.12
✎
09:57
|
(7) А что можно сказать по твоему вопросу? Код хотя бы выложи! Отладчик в конце концов для таких вещей есть. Посмотри, как работает код в типовой и во внешней форме. И зашибись потом
|
|
|
10
Капитан О
01.03.12
✎
09:58
|
+(9) об стену
|
|
|
11
a103307
01.03.12
✎
14:09
|
(9)
Я сравнил оригинальную форму с моей в отладчике.
Такие наблюдения:
В оригинальной форме у
Макет.ПолучитьОбласть("ВсегоКОплате|НомерСтроки");
Значение табличный документ.
У меня там ошибка:
{(1)}: Ошибка при вызове метода контекста (ПолучитьОбласть)
Что значит значение табличный документ? Как его прописать в моей форме?
|
|
|
12
Капитан О
01.03.12
✎
14:13
|
(11) заведи уже себе такую область
|
|
Чтобы обнаруживать ошибки, программист должен иметь ум, которому доставляет удовольствие находить изъяны там, где, казалось, царят красота и совершенство. Фредерик Брукс-младший